  • Registered Users, Registered Users 2 Posts: 6,556 ✭✭✭dobman88


    I don't think it would be a success tbh. A pro gambler might put a €1000 bet on but his bankroll could take the hit if it lost. Gambling is about having good bankroll management and being disciplined as much as anything else.

    If you have 1k that you can use for gambling, give yourself a % for each bet and never bet more than that %. Be disciplined and apply bankroll management.

    e.g. Bank is €1000 and your % is 10%. Bet €100 at odds of 2/1 and win. Your bank would then be €1200 so your bet would be €120 and so on.

    Gambling can be fun if you go about it the right way
